Output 81bc5dd67e6791345d48e0dc35ec4477dabfc51b8b667ea34005c19304c96818:1

value
5006262
script pubkey
OP_0 OP_PUSHBYTES_20 289cb80433789cb63a4a4b85d0c58d8690b4de1c
address
bc1q9zwtsppn0zwtvwj2fwzap3vds6gtfhsukjl085
transaction
81bc5dd67e6791345d48e0dc35ec4477dabfc51b8b667ea34005c19304c96818
confirmations
242918
spent
true